The meteorological forecast from the Civil Aviation Authority’s Meteorological Division predicts that Monday's weather will be partly cloudy to partly sunny, with fog over the highlands and stable temperatures. Humidity levels remain high, with a chance of light drizzle in the northern highlands.
According to the report:
– General situation: Typical summer weather will impact Lebanon and the eastern Mediterranean, persisting throughout the week. Temperatures in the interior and mountainous regions are expected to be above seasonal averages, while coastal areas will remain humid, intensifying the sensation of heat.
Typical August temperature ranges are 24-32°C in Tripoli, 25-33°C in Beirut, and 18-35°C in Zahle.
Warnings have been issued regarding sun exposure and forest fire risks.
